Transponder Keys

Transponder chips, in contrast to traditional keys, are equipped with electronic circuits that communicate with the car. When you insert your key into the ignition the chip transmits an electronic signal to the vehicle that matches the code it has stored. Once the codes have been matched, the engine will start. This is a great security feature that deters thieves from attempting to hot wire your vehicle.

If you happen to lose your transponder key, or it's stolen, you'll need to visit a locksmith to get an alternative. These professionals have specialized equipment to copy the chip from your existing key and then program it into the new key. This procedure is more costly and complicated than just getting a standard key for your car, but it is the only way to guarantee that your car will start.

If you are looking to replace a lost transponder, you should seek out an expert who has experience working with your vehicle. They'll need to be aware of the specific model of your vehicle and the immobilizer system. This will ensure that the new key is compatible with your ignition correctly and works with the rest of the security features.

Laser-Cut Keys

If you've purchased a newer car in the last few months, then you might have noticed your key is a lot different than keys used in older cars. This is because of the fact that modern automobiles require a laser-cut key. These keys are also known as a sidewinder. They are produced using lasers which can cut deeper than mechanical keys. They are also more durable and can be hard to duplicate.

If a person is able to obtain one of these keys, then they'll need to have it programmed to their particular vehicle in order for it to work. This can be done by a locksmith or a dealership. The process of creating a new key is done quickly and is generally less expensive than replacing a standard key.

Laser-cut keys are a significant improvement over a basic transponder chip key, as they have an integrated security system within them. The key emits a signal that is sent to the vehicle's computers and then relays the message to the ignition and lock. The driver can unlock the doors and start the engine just like a regular car key.

This type of key is more expensive and complicated to manufacture, because it requires specialized equipment that is not easily accessible at hardware stores. This makes them more expensive, and also more difficult for thieves to get.

Laser-cut keys add an additional layer in security for vehicles. They are harder to bump or pick up than a traditional key, and feature unique key patterns that decrease the possibility that someone could use the same key for multiple vehicles. These keys aren't able to be duplicated since they require a high-tech machine and sophisticated software. This is the reason why they are more secure and an excellent investment for car owners. Double-edged Keys

Some cars have double-edge keys that have cuts on both sides of the key. These keys are more difficult to select because they require a tool that cuts both sides of the key. They are also known as symmetrical cut key. They are more prevalent on older models of vehicles but can also be found in vending machines, lock boxes and high security padlocks.

You'll need to take the key with two edges to your dealer to obtain an alternative. The cost replacement car key will depend on the type of keys, the year they were manufactured and if there is a remote or fob attached.

The majority of modern keys include a transponder in the key head that communicates with the car to check whether the key is legitimate and able to start it. They are much harder to steal, and are advertised as a deterrent to theft. These keys are typically more expensive than mechanical keys, and they must be programmed at an authorized dealer.

A lot of dealers will charge for this service, but locksmiths can be less expensive. Regardless of who you choose it is crucial to ensure that they have the tools needed for your particular vehicle. A good place to begin is to examine the keyway profile of the new key against your existing one. The key shank must be the same distance from the shoulder to tip as the key you have currently.

In certain instances, the dealer will need to order a replacement key. However you can obtain a spare key at an independent auto parts store or on the internet. If you decide to do this be cautious as the quality of the key can differ greatly. The key you receive might not fit correctly and could result in an issue such as a malfunction or other issues in the event that it's not made for your specific car.

Keyless Entry

Usually found on cars with newer models, these are the most convenient keys. They emit signals that allow drivers to unlock their car and even turn it on without inserting a key into the ignition. They can also control other functions, such as rolling down windows, opening the trunk and recording memory seat presets. These keys are easy to replace by the typical car owner. However, if you do lose your key fob it is a lot more complicated to find someone willing to help you.

If you're looking to purchase an replacement for a key fob which utilizes a transponder then the best option is to go to the dealership. They'll likely need to order the replacement and then pair it with your car and could mean a long wait before you can use it again. It might be more affordable to ask an automotive locksmith to cut and program an extra key for you, if you're on a budget.

You can also save money by buying an old key from an agent. You can usually find them for much less than you'd pay at a dealership and some are a fraction of the price of a brand new one. You should always check that the key and key fob are in good condition.

Certain key fobs have the metal component of a standard key in plastic, so you can lock and unlock your car with a single push. These key fobs are usually cheaper than other types of fobs. However, you'll still need to use the metal key in order to start your car key lost replacement.

You can program some key fobs using the instructions in the owner's manual. Some require special equipment, which is typically only available through a dealership. If you lose yours, you'll have to get it transported to the dealership and show proof of ownership before they are able to replace it.
